Biography

Anna, the daughter of Martin and Mary Trimm, is sometimes identified as Ann Adey who married David Reid, Thomas Leawood, and Aaron Belbin.

She would have been very young to have married David (in 1861), however. And it is more likely she died at some point before 1864, when her sister Ann was born.
